SCANP's proposed findings of fact regarding the financial qualificatiens of the Applicants are due today, November 5, 1979.

Although SCANP has substantially complaced a draft of the.e findings, counsel's involvement in the Skagit County Planning Co= mission recone hearings has consumed e greater amount of time and attention than was anticipa" aarlier.

We request therefore a brief extension of time in which to file and serve the proposed findings until Friday, Nove=ber 9, 1979.

In view of the three week extensions accorded to other parties we trust that a brief extension for SCANP's proposed findings on financial qualifications will neither occasier undue hardship to any party nor conflict with any schedules envisioned by the Board.
